Sourcing Eyelashes from China

China is the primary hub for eyelash production, accounting for over 90% of global output. This dominance is attributed to several factors: low labor costs, skilled workforce, and advanced manufacturing technologies. However, navigating the complex Chinese supply chain can be challenging for foreign buyers. Here are some key considerations:
Identify Reputable Suppliers: Thoroughly research potential suppliers through online directories, industry exhibitions, and personal referrals. Verify their licenses, certifications, and customer reviews.
Specify Product Requirements: Clearly define your product specifications, including lash length, thickness, curl, and material. Provide detailed samples or reference images to ensure alignment.
Negotiate Pricing and Payment Terms: Negotiate competitive prices based on market demand and your order volume. Secure favorable payment terms, such as flexible deposits and graduated discounts.

Quality Control in Eyelash Production

Maintaining high-quality standards is paramount in the eyelash industry. The following steps can help ensure you receive superior products:
Pre-Production Sample Approval: Request pre-production samples for quality evaluation before mass production commences.
Factory Inspection: Conduct on-site factory inspections to assess production facilities, equipment, and hygiene standards.
Third-Party Inspection: Engage an independent inspection agency to verify product compliance with specifications and safety regulations.

Industry Trends and Future Prospects

The eyelash industry is constantly evolving, driven by technological advancements and consumer preferences. Some notable trends to watch include:
Magnetic Eyelashes: These innovative lashes use magnets to attach, offering convenience and easy application.
Volume Eyelash Extensions: These techniques involve applying multiple thin lashes to each natural lash, creating a voluminous and dramatic look.
Sustainable Eyelash Materials: Consumers are increasingly demanding environmentally friendly products, such as faux mink and synthetic silk lashes.
